IVTCC 2.0: A Prospective Multicenter Ventricular Tachycardia Catheter Ablation Registry

NCT04520347 · Status: ENROLLING_BY_INVITATION ·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 10000

Last updated 2025-12-15

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This is a prospective multi-center international registry. The objective of this registry is to collect prospective data on patients undergoing catheter ablation for Ventricular Tachycardia (VT) and Premature Ventricular Contractions (PVC). The registry will be used for clinical monitoring, research, and quality improvement purposes.

Conditions

  • Ventricular Arrhythmia
  • Ventricular Tachycardia
  • Premature Ventricular Contraction (PVC)
  • Cardiomyopathy
